Class 5 / E-63 (Locobase 13736)

Data from MP 8-1936 Locomotive Diagrams supplied in May 2005 by Allen Stanley from his extensive Rail Data Exchange. Locobase 7819 describes the orgins of this southern Texas railroad. Works number was 1229 in 1912.

This little American owns a couple of distinctions. It was the only locomotive bought new by the Sausage Route and it was one of the first rod-driven engines to be supplied by Lima. It was small, oil-fired, and not especially noteworthy, but useful and long-lived.
